Re: Newbb Hack - updating for 2.0.7?

An old post and long so if you are talking about seeing private forums when you shouldn't (this hack has always worked great for me) then yes, cache will cause problems.

In general you don't want to cache anything that should look different between user groups. This would include Forums with this hack since the view will may show private forum listings for the wrong people or not show private forums for those that should. Depends on who made the current cache entry and as such is random.

However, the rights are still active. Clicking a private forum you shouldn't see will not let you in.

FYI, this hack is still working great on 2.0.7.3
